Oil Shortage!

So I am having a very difficult time finding engine oil! I have some T6 for one more oil change however the shelves are void of just about all diesel engine oil around here. I even looked for Travelers oil at TSC with no luck. Anyone else experiencing this? I don't get it, there is plenty of gasser oil. Also I have asked this before several years ago but what are your thoughts on Super Tech? I have been using ST synthetic in my gas engines for some time now and I have researched it enough to know that it is a good oil however I have not found enough data on their diesel oil. I would prefer synthetic but I am ok with conventional especially if it is my only option. Walmart does have some SuperTech on the shelf and although it is not on the Ford approved oil list is does have their standard on the back of the bottle. Maybe if Ford updated their list it would be on there? I think the latest list is dated May 2018. It is very difficult to find T-6 here in east TN. I was in central Florida for Christmas and it was in short supply there too. I did manage to grab three gallons at Advance Auto Parts while in Florida. Just yesterday I was able to grab three gallons each at two separate O'Reilly's here in east TN. The guys at each of those stores told me they aren't receiving steady shipments - it comes in randomly. The O'Reilly's I went to first yesterday hadn't put it on the shelf yet - it was in a box sitting on the dock. I only saw it because I went to dump used oil and saw it still on the pallet from the truck. He told me their truck came that morning. I figured the other O'Reilly's near me was probably serviced by that same truck so I took a chance and went by and I scored three gallons there too.
